The amygdala, cerebellum, and many other brain regions have been implicated in autism. [15]Unlike some brain disorders which have clear molecular hallmarks that can be observed in every affected individual, such as Alzheimer's disease or Parkinson's disease, autism does not have a unifying mechanism at the molecular, cellular, or systems level.

The amygdala is one of the best-understood brain regions with regard to differences between the sexes. The amygdala is larger in males than females, in children aged 7 to 11, [17] adult humans, [18] and adult rats. [19] There is considerable growth within the first few years of structural development in both male and female amygdalae. [20]

Brain studies have shown several amygdaloid impairments among those with ASD. The amygdala in those with nonspeaking autism have less volume compared to controls, contain a higher density of neurons suggesting hyperconnection, and show a negative correlation between amygdala size and impairment severity among subjects. The average length of the uncinate fasciculus is 45 mm with a range 40–49 mm. Its volume in adults is 1425.9±138.6 mm 3, being slightly larger in men, at 1504.3±150.4, than women 1378.5±107.4. [2] It has three parts: a ventral or frontal extension, an intermediary segment called the isthmus or insular segment and a temporal or dorsal segment.
